@ -0,0 +1,43 @@
-- Convert a pre-flat-schema room save into the current { objects = { ... } }
-- format. Usage:
-- lua tools/migrate_legacy_room.lua legacy.sav migrated.sav
local inputPath, outputPath = arg[1], arg[2]
assert(inputPath and outputPath, "usage: lua tools/migrate_legacy_room.lua legacy.sav migrated.sav")
local input = assert(io.open(inputPath, "r"))
local chunk, err = load("return " .. input:read("*a"))
input:close()
assert(chunk, err)
local legacy = chunk()
local objects = {}
local function append(class, object, includeColor)
local converted = {
class = class,
x = object.x,
y = object.y,
}
if includeColor ~= false then converted.color = object.color end
table.insert(objects, converted)
end
for _, color in ipairs({ "red", "green", "blue" }) do
for _, object in ipairs(legacy.players[color] or {}) do append("player", object) end
-- Doors are shared between color layers in the current schema, so they have
-- no color field when serialized.
for _, object in ipairs(legacy.doors[color] or {}) do append("door", object, false) end
for _, object in ipairs(legacy.static_walls[color] or {}) do append("static_wall", object) end
-- The legacy wall sprite was renamed to box when assets became data-driven.
for _, object in ipairs(legacy.walls[color] or {}) do append("box", object) end
for _, object in ipairs(legacy.switches[color] or {}) do append("switch", object) end
end
for _, sage in pairs(legacy.sages or {}) do
table.insert(objects, { class = "npc", x = sage.x, y = sage.y })
end
require "libs/TSerial"
local output = assert(io.open(outputPath, "w"))
output:write(TSerial.pack({ objects = objects }, nil, true))
output:close()

@ -0,0 +1,70 @@
-- Make a first 18x18 layout from the exit links preserved in the legacy saves.
-- Some old test rooms share the same one-way exit, so a grid cannot represent
-- every such link at once. Those rooms are still placed, but isolated, rather
-- than silently overwriting a room that already occupies that neighbour.
function seedWorldFromLegacyExits(world)
local available = {}
for _, name in ipairs(world:listRoomNames()) do available[name] = true end
local legacy = {}
for name in pairs(available) do
local raw = readFromSource("rooms/_pre_migration_backup/" .. name .. ".sav")
if raw then
local ok, save = pcall(TSerial.unpack, raw)
if ok and type(save) == "table" then legacy[name] = save.exits or {} end
end
end
world.rooms, world.roomByName = {}, {}
local root = available.start and "start" or world:listRoomNames()[1]
if not root then return { placed = 0, links = 0, conflicts = 0 } end
world:_putRoom(root, 9, 11)
local queue, queued = { root }, { [root] = true }
local directions = {
top = { x = 0, y = -1 }, right = { x = 1, y = 0 },
bottom = { x = 0, y = 1 }, left = { x = -1, y = 0 },
}
local order = { "top", "right", "bottom", "left" }
local links, conflicts = 0, 0
local index = 1
while index <= #queue do
local name = queue[index]
local source = world:roomLocation(name)
for _, exit in ipairs(order) do
local target = legacy[name] and legacy[name][exit]
target = target and tostring(target)
local direction = directions[exit]
if target and available[target] then
local x, y = source.x + direction.x, source.y + direction.y
local occupied, known = world:roomAt(x, y), world:roomLocation(target)
if world:isInBounds(x, y) and (not occupied or occupied == target) and (not known or (known.x == x and known.y == y)) then
if not known then world:_putRoom(target, x, y) end
links = links + 1
if not queued[target] then table.insert(queue, target); queued[target] = true end
else
conflicts = conflicts + 1
end
end
end
index = index + 1
end
-- Keep every migrated room visible/selectable without creating accidental
-- exits between the disconnected legacy variants.
for _, name in ipairs(world:listRoomNames()) do
if not world:roomLocation(name) then
local placed = false
for y = 1, world.height do
for x = 1, world.width do
if not world:roomAt(x, y) then
local nearby = false
for dy = -1, 1 do for dx = -1, 1 do if world:roomAt(x + dx, y + dy) then nearby = true end end end
if not nearby then world:_putRoom(name, x, y); placed = true; break end
end
end
if placed then break end
end
end
end
world:save()
return { placed = #world.rooms, links = links, conflicts = conflicts }
end
